REQUIREMENTS 3.1 Q
17、ualification - Indicators furnished under this specification shall be products which are qualified for listing on the applicable qualified products list at the time set for opening of bids (see 4. and 6.). 3.2 Selection of government documents. Except as provided in 3.2.1 and 3.2.2, specifications a
18、nd standards for necessary commodities and services not specified herein shall be selected in accordance with MIL-STD-143. 3.2.1 Standard parts. With the exception of 3.2.2, MS and AN standard parts shall be used where they suit the purpose. They shall be identified on the drawings by their part num
19、bers. 3.2.2 Commercial parts. Commercial parts having suitable properties shall be used when, on the date of invitations for bids, there are no suitable standard parts. In any case, commercial parts such as screws, bolts, nuts, cotter pins, having suitable properties, may be used provided: (a) They
20、can be replaced by the standard parts (MS or AN) without a 1 t era t ion. (b) The corresponding standard part numbers are referenced in the parts list, and if practicable, on the contractors drawings. . 4 o Provided by IHSNot for ResaleNo reproduction or networking permitted without license from IHS
21、-,-,-3.3 Materials. Materials shall conform to applicable specifications and shall be as specified herein. Materials for which there are no applicable specifications, or which are not specifically described herein, shall be of the best quality, of the lightest practicable weight and suitable for the
22、 purpose intended, 3.3.1 Critical materials. Noncritical materiais shall be used where practicable. Where the use of a critical material is essential to meet specification requirements, the material used shall be the least critical of those which are adequate for the purpose. 3.3.2 Nonmagnetic mater
23、ials. Nonmagnetic materials shall be used for all parts of the indicator except where magnetic materials are essential. 3.3.3 Metals. Metals shall be of the corrosion resistant type, or shall be suitably protected as specified herein to resist corrosion due to fuels, salt spray, or atmospheric condi
24、tions to which the indicator may be subjected when in storage or during normal service life. - 3.3.3.1 Dissimilar metals. Dissimilar metals as defined in MIL-STD-889 shall not be used in intimate contact with each other, unless protection against electrolytic corrosion is provided. 3.3.3.2 Magnesium
